Environmental drivers of variability in the movement ecology of turkey vultures (Cathartes aura) in North and South America
Variation is key to the adaptability of species and their ability to survive changes to the
Earth's climate and habitats. Plasticity in movement strategies allows a species to better
track spatial dynamics of habitat quality. We describe the mechanisms that shape the
movement of a long-distance migrant bird (turkey vulture, Cathartes aura) across two
continents using satellite tracking coupled with remote-sensing science. Using nearly 10
years of data from 24 satellite-tracked vultures in four distinct populations, we describe an …
